WebThe Australian Football League (AFL) is the sport’s only fully professional competition and is Australia’s wealthiest sporting body. The AFL Grand Final has the highest attendance of any club championship in the world. WebAustralia is one of the largest countries on Earth, and the only country that covers an entire continent. Although it is rich in natural resources and has a lot of fertile land, more than one-third of Australia is desert.
